Here's the follow-up:
Seems like my disk is dying, as the reallocated sectors increase and the
errors logged (see attached file)
The disk has 4 months of light usage, should still be covered by warranty.
Should I RMA it ?
Is it me, or hard disk quality has been lowered with the increasing capacity
size?
A workmate has seen die 2 SAMSUNG hard disks in one week of purchase, both
500gb in size
At work I've seen die a lot of WD5001ABYS and WD5002ABYS, both models
supossed to be enterprise-level quality, but again failing in the 6-12
months range.
I'm the only one suffering this?
Thanks.
Javier

>> -----BEGIN PGP SIGNED MESSAGE-----
>> I would worry more about Spin_Retry_Count which changed from 0 to 1
>> after MX1A. If you removed drive for performing the update it could
>> be related to a poorly connected cable or some power-supply issue.
>>
>> Cheers.
